admin 管理员组

文章数量: 1087139


2024年4月18日发(作者:jquery怎么写ajax)

Mac命令行如何使用Vim进行代码编辑和快

速导航

Vim是一款强大的文本编辑器,被广泛应用于代码编辑和文件修改。

通过命令行界面,在Mac操作系统上使用Vim可以提高代码编辑的效

率和便捷性。本文将介绍Mac命令行如何使用Vim进行代码编辑和快

速导航的具体方法。

一、打开命令行界面

在Mac操作系统中,通过使用Terminal(终端)或其他支持命令行

的应用程序打开命令行界面。你可以在“应用程序”文件夹中找到

Terminal,双击打开。

二、进入Vim编辑模式

在命令行界面中输入以下命令,以进入Vim编辑模式:

```

vim

```

按下回车键后,你会看到一个空白的屏幕,这是Vim的编辑界面。

三、打开文件

在Vim编辑界面中,输入以下命令来打开一个文件:

```

vim 文件名

```

其中,文件名可以是绝对路径或相对路径。例如,要打开Desktop

目录下的文件,可以输入以下命令:

```

vim ~/Desktop/

```

这样,文件就会在Vim编辑器中打开。

四、在Vim中编辑代码

一旦文件打开,你可以使用Vim进行代码编辑。以下是一些常用的

Vim编辑命令:

1. 插入文本:按下键盘上的“i”键,进入插入模式。此时,你可以自

由地编辑文件内容。

2. 退出插入模式:按下键盘上的“Esc”键,退出插入模式。

3. 保存文件:在命令行模式下,输入以下命令保存文件:

```

:w

```

4. 保存并退出:在命令行模式下,输入以下命令保存文件并退出

Vim编辑器:

```

:wq

```

以上是最基本的Vim编辑操作,你可以自行探索更多高级功能。

五、Vim快速导航

除了基本的代码编辑功能,Vim还提供了一些快速导航的命令,帮

助你在代码文件中快速移动和定位。以下是一些常用的Vim导航命令:

1. 上下左右移动光标:使用键盘上的方向键,或按下“h”(左)、“j”

(下)、“k”(上)、“l”(右)来移动光标。

2. 快速跳转到行首:按下键盘上的“0”键,光标会跳转到当前行的

行首。

3. 快速跳转到行尾:按下键盘上的“$”键,光标会跳转到当前行的

行尾。

4. 快速跳转到指定行:在命令行模式下,输入以下命令并按下回车,

光标会跳转到指定行号。

```

:行号

```

例如,要跳转到第10行,输入:

```

:10

```

5. 查找关键词:在命令行模式下,输入以下命令并按下回车,Vim

会定位到第一个匹配的关键词处。

```

/关键词

```

六、退出Vim编辑器

当你完成编辑后,可以使用以下命令退出Vim编辑器:

```

:q

```

如果文件已修改但未保存,Vim会提示你保存修改。如果确实想退

出而不保存,可以使用以下命令:

```

:q!

```

如果你已经保存修改并且想退出Vim编辑器,可以使用以下命令:

```

:q

```

综上所述,通过命令行界面在Mac上使用Vim进行代码编辑和快

速导航是一种有效的方式。希望本文介绍的基本操作和快捷导航命令

能为你带来更高效的代码编写体验。通过不断练习和探索,你将掌握

更多Vim的高级功能,提升编码效率。


本文标签: 编辑 使用 命令行 代码